Hidden impact of domestic abuse on doctors revealed in MDU journal

The hidden impact of domestic abuse on healthcare professionals has been revealed by the Royal Medical Benevolent Fund (RMBF), in the latest edition of the Medical Defence Union (MDU) journal. Govt refuses to foot Tory Olympics bill

Two senior Tories travelling to the Beijing Olympics have had their request for public funding denied by the government. Jeremy Hunt, shadow culture secretary, and Hugh Robertson, shadow sports secretary, are travelling to China for five days to witness what is involved in running such a big event before it come to the UK. Olympic success in 2012 threatened by lack of planning

Lack of appropriate planning and private sector fundraising threatens UK athletes’ success in the 2012 Olympic Games, according to a Committee of Public Accounts (CPA) report. In one report regarding potential team success, Great Britain’s medal table goals were set at second and fourth respectively for the 2012 Olympic and Paralympic Games.
